Folia Linguistica Historica
Acta Societatis Linguisticae Europaeae
Editor: Jacek Fisiak

ISSN 0165-4004

Vol. XXI / 1-2 (2000)


Articles

Paul Brosman
On the origin of the PIE neuter plural

Gontzal Aldai
Split ergativity in Basque: The pre-Basque antipassive-imperfective hypothesis

Judith Mara Kish
æ and eo development in the Cotton Nero A.x: A new dialect feature

Bernhard Diensberg
The etymology of Modern English "girl" revisited

Antonio Bertacca
The Great Vowel Shift and Anglo-French loanwords: A rejoinder to Diensberg 1998

Witold Manczak
Criticism of naturalness: Naturalness or frequency of occurrence?

Irene Sawicka
A medieval phonetic Balkanism

Patricia Poussa
Reanalysing "whose": The actuation and spread of the invariable who
relative in Early Modern English

Mark R. V. Southern
Caribbean Creoles as a convergence conduit: English "boss" and
"overseer", Ndjuká "basía", Sranan "basja", Jamaican "busha", and Dutch
"baas(-je)"


Review Article

Bernhard Diensberg
How to improve our current etymological dictionaries: Critical remarks
on "The Kenkyusha Dictionary of English Etymology (KDEE)", edited by
Yoshio Terasawa


Review

Witold Manczak
Damaris Nübling, Prinzipien der Irregularisierung. Ein kontrastive
Analyse von zehn Verben in zehn germanischen Sprachen
